lisitsyn1HeikoS: well I see one great thing we probably oversee now01:02
lisitsyn1how do we handle vectors/matrices already loaded to the GPU01:02
@HeikoSlisitsyn1: i like discussing things, so shoot01:02
@HeikoSlisitsyn1: very good point01:03
lisitsyn1sgvector is not the thing for that01:03
@HeikoSlisitsyn1: impossible to handle with an interface that can easily switch between modes01:03
lisitsyn1otherwise we lose a lot01:03
@HeikoSlisitsyn1: yeah01:03
@HeikoSlisitsyn1: so what about having some subclasses to do these things?01:03
@HeikoSyou know01:03
@HeikoSsame class but with the "definitely GPU" label01:04
@HeikoSso that you can choose to use those, and they dont work without GPU, but have same interface as the others01:04
lisitsyn1subclasses of what?01:04
@HeikoSof the std vector operation01:04
lisitsyn1dot <- gpu dot?01:04
lisitsyn1still the problem is here01:05
lisitsyn1if we have an interface that just uses sgvector01:05
lisitsyn1we *always* transfer stuff from ram to gpu01:05
@HeikoSno but the subclass can reimplement that01:05
lisitsyn1but if has interface like01:05
@HeikoSI mean those are instances of classes so they can do whatever they want to produce the result01:05
@HeikoSnot static methods01:06
lisitsyn1dot(SGVector a, SGVector b)01:06
lisitsyn1SGVector is not capable of having some handle in the gpu memory01:06
@HeikoSso the gpu class could load the thing into GPU upon construction01:06
lisitsyn1right?01:06
@HeikoSyeah I agree01:06
lisitsyn1ahh01:06
lisitsyn1so you mean01:06
@HeikoSbut cant we handle that if we dont use static methods?01:06
lisitsyn1we need to have linear operators01:06
lisitsyn1instead of vectors/matrices01:06
lisitsyn1then we are good to do that with gpu01:07
@HeikoSyeah I guess01:07
@HeikoSsame with convolutions01:07
lisitsyn1yeah I get it01:07
@HeikoSalso linear operations01:07
@HeikoSso same interface01:07
lisitsyn1I haven't thought of that actually01:09
